Selecting an Appropriate Aquarium
It is important to know what kind of aquarium may suit particular fish better when planning a fish home. First of all, a bigger aquarium means that there will be some stability regarding temperature, water level, and other factors. Moreover, it will be easier to make a natural environment by putting some plants, rocks, and other accessories inside. Therefore, it is important to purchase a suitable aquarium before going to a pet shop. The type of fish matters in this case because there are two types of fish – saltwater and freshwater. Thus, people should buy different aquariums.
After getting an aquarium, one should prepare it for fish before introducing them into the environment. This step is crucial to prevent future diseases or problems with water balance. One should cycle the tank, which takes about several days or weeks. To do it, a person may purchase bacteria supplements for an aquarium or let it be cycled through natural means by putting some fish food into it.
Water Quality Maintenance
In order to have healthy fish, one should monitor water conditions in the aquarium and maintain optimal parameters. There are some water tests, which can be performed at home to control water parameters. They are usually available in pet shops. If a person wants to check water pH, nitrate level, and other important parameters, he/she may get a testing kit and do the procedure according to its instructions.
In order to maintain water parameters properly, one should perform water change once a week. During water changing procedure, one should use an aquarium siphon, which helps to remove excess of waste, dead leaves, and other substances, which might affect the quality of the water. Moreover, tap water should not be used for such purposes because it contains a lot of harmful ingredients like chlorine and chloramines.
Developing a Proper Fish Diet
One of the most important aspects, which should be taken into consideration when taking care of aquarium fish, is a proper diet. Each fish has a different type of nutritional needs. Hence, people are supposed to do some research before buying food for pets. Nevertheless, there are several common rules, which apply to fish diets in general. For example, it is believed that fish require food that consists of a great percentage of proteins, as well as vitamins and mineral components.
Fish can be fed with flakes or pellets that can be purchased in specialized shops. Moreover, one can enrich fish diets with some additional components like freeze-dried, frozen, or live foods such as brine shrimps. It is important to follow a certain schedule and to avoid overfeeding in order to maintain fish health. An automatic fish feeder is a great device, which can be helpful in providing fish with enough food regularly.
Providing a Suitable Environment
Another important step that may influence the state of the aquarium and its inhabitants is creating a balanced environment, which consists of different elements. Fish should have enough hiding places and enough free space in the aquarium in order to feel comfortable and safe. Plants, rocks, and other accessories, which can contribute to the natural appearance of the aquarium are also important.
People should select special plants, which are supposed to grow in tanks. There are many species of such plants. Popular species are Anacharis, Java Moss, and Amazon Swords. In order to provide fish with appropriate environment, one should make some research and choose proper plants.
Aquarium Diseases and Issues Handling
Despite all efforts that are made in order to provide fish with optimal conditions for living, it may occur that fish get some diseases and develop some abnormalities. People should be aware of common fish diseases and their symptoms and treat them in time. Common diseases include different bacterial or fungal infections, as well as parasites. Fish behavior and appearance can show people if there is something wrong with them.
Handling diseases requires following some steps. Firstly, one should be very careful when giving medicine to fish because it is easy to overdose them. It is possible to search for a disease treatment in specialized forums and on websites of pet stores. After finding the necessary information, one should give fish medication in accordance with its directions.
